隨著信息技術(shù)的快速發(fā)展,在許多要求實(shí)時(shí)性的應(yīng)用場合,通信系統(tǒng)必須保證傳輸實(shí)時(shí)性的確定性、精確性、穩(wěn)定性。網(wǎng)絡(luò)時(shí)間協(xié)議(networktimeprotocol,NTP)由美國德拉瓦大學(xué)的David LMills教授于1985年提出,是用于設(shè)計(jì)使Internet上的計(jì)算機(jī)保持時(shí)間同步的一種通信協(xié)議。
網(wǎng)絡(luò)時(shí)間協(xié)議可以估算出數(shù)據(jù)包在Internet上的往返延遲,并可獨(dú)立地估算計(jì)算機(jī)時(shí)鐘偏差。在大多數(shù)的環(huán)境中,NTP可以提供l~50ms的可靠時(shí)間源。 在實(shí)際很多應(yīng)用中,秒級的精確度就足夠了。在這種情況下,簡單網(wǎng)絡(luò)時(shí)間協(xié)議(simplenetwork time protocol,SNTP)出現(xiàn)了,它通過簡化原來的訪問協(xié)議,在保證時(shí)間精確度的前提下,使得對網(wǎng)絡(luò)時(shí)間的開發(fā)和應(yīng)用變得容易。NTP簡介:
簡單網(wǎng)絡(luò)時(shí)間協(xié)議(SNTP)由RFC1769文檔定義。SNTP能夠與NTP 協(xié)議具有互操作性,即SNTP 客戶可以與NTP服務(wù)器協(xié)同工作,同樣NTP 客戶也可以接收SNTP 服務(wù)器發(fā)出的授時(shí)信息。
這是因?yàn)镹TP 和SNTP的數(shù)據(jù)包格式是一樣的,計(jì)算客戶時(shí)間、時(shí)間偏差以及包往返時(shí)延的算法也是一樣的。因此NTP 和SNTP 實(shí)際上是無法分割的。
時(shí)鐘層的概念:
時(shí)鐘的層數(shù)決定了時(shí)鐘的準(zhǔn)確度,其取值范圍為0~15。參考時(shí)鐘的層數(shù)取值范圍為0~15,準(zhǔn)確度從0到15依次遞減。層數(shù)為0的時(shí)鐘處于子網(wǎng)特殊位置,是基準(zhǔn)時(shí)間參考源,目前普遍采用GPS的UTC時(shí)間源。
NTP 工作原理:
?雙向時(shí)延:d =(T4-T1)-(T3-T2)
?A相對B的時(shí)間差:offset =((T2-T1)+(T3-T4))/2
?如果往返的傳輸時(shí)間相等,根據(jù)四個(gè)時(shí)刻可以求得時(shí)鐘偏差和傳輸時(shí)間
Authenticator字段可選,用來存放認(rèn)證密鑰或加密碼
NTP工作模式:
1.服務(wù)器/客戶端模式
2.對等體模式
3.廣播模式
4.組播模式
責(zé)任編輯:dhj
-
通信協(xié)議
+關(guān)注
關(guān)注
28文章
1033瀏覽量
41154 -
時(shí)鐘
+關(guān)注
關(guān)注
11文章
1898瀏覽量
133199 -
模式
+關(guān)注
關(guān)注
0文章
65瀏覽量
13624
發(fā)布評論請先 登錄
網(wǎng)絡(luò)中為什么要部署NTP時(shí)鐘服務(wù)器?
工業(yè)計(jì)算機(jī)與商用計(jì)算機(jī)的區(qū)別有哪些

衛(wèi)星授時(shí)服務(wù)器 國內(nèi)ntp網(wǎng)絡(luò)授時(shí)服務(wù)器的發(fā)展方向 北斗對時(shí)服務(wù)器

計(jì)算機(jī)網(wǎng)絡(luò)入門指南

時(shí)間的秩序:NTP網(wǎng)絡(luò)同步時(shí)鐘與數(shù)字化協(xié)同的隱性邏輯
NTP時(shí)間服務(wù)器校準(zhǔn)方法詳解

加州理工學(xué)院開發(fā)出超100GHz時(shí)鐘速度的全光計(jì)算機(jī)
計(jì)算機(jī)網(wǎng)絡(luò)架構(gòu)的演進(jìn)
NTP服務(wù)器在云計(jì)算中的作用
常見NTP服務(wù)器軟件比較
云端超級計(jì)算機(jī)使用教程
工業(yè)中使用哪種計(jì)算機(jī)?

以RK3568為例,ARM核心板如何實(shí)現(xiàn)NTP精準(zhǔn)時(shí)間同步?

計(jì)算機(jī)局域網(wǎng)技術(shù)是什么
網(wǎng)絡(luò)時(shí)間服務(wù)器模塊:衛(wèi)星時(shí)間同步的管理神器

評論